I'm new to this game. We have a bigger camper for on road camping. Then we have a lot of car camping gear like a 12x15' spike style wall tent and lots of cooking, coolers, and cots and such for camping off road. We couldn't fit the gear in any or our smaller SUV (We used to have a 2500 Suburban, now have a 2009 Jeep Commander and 2012 VW Touareg TDI). So we went looking for at least a cargo trailer. Well they are about $2800 around here for a standard 4x8' cargo but would need some off road mods, and I figured might as well outfit the inside. Seemed like I would be over $5000 in no time, and I really have no time for a project anyway. So this seems like the ticket. It was $11500 with $308 doc fees and no sales tax so $11808 out the door. I have to drive over next Saturday to pick it up. I haven't seen any threads on this camper but to me it seems like a good value. Was looking at the smallest Geo Pros as well but they are a good $4000 more in our area and nobody has any in stock until late spring.
